say it: moo-BAH-rik
mubarak is a noun meaning "Egyptian statesman who became president in 1981 after Sadat was assassinated (born in 1929)". It carries one recorded sense.
Egyptian statesman who became president in 1981 after Sadat was assassinated (born in 1929)
